Mixed Markets Ahead of US Inflation Data Amid Strait of Hormuz Tensions

Global markets were mixed on Tuesday ahead of the release of US consumer price index (CPI) data, which is expected to show a slowdown in inflation rates. The US military's intervention against another vessel in the Strait of Hormuz fueled doubts over a lasting peace agreement between Iran and Oman.

The strait's closure would significantly impact oil supplies, driving up prices amid already high energy costs. This, in turn, would put additional pressure on central banks to adjust their policy roadmaps.

Chicago Fed President Austan Goolsbee stated that inflation is the biggest problem facing the US economy currently. The upcoming CPI data will likely influence the Federal Reserve's decisions by year-end and could lead to sector- and stock-specific volatility in the markets.
